Abstract

The invention relates to glasses with a remote monitoring function. The glasses comprise a glasses frame, two lenses are inlaid in the glasses frame, a signal transceiver and a PH detector are arranged between the lenses from top to bottom, an active buzzer is arranged at one side of one lens, a miniature lamp is arranged at the other side of the other lens, the two ends of the glasses frame are movably connected with a first glasses leg and a second glasses leg respectively, a miniature electrical storage device is arranged in an inner cavity of the first glasses leg, and an PLC chip is arranged at one side of the miniature electrical storage device. The glasses are not prone to falling by means of a designed anti-slipping rope and are more convenient to wear, the arranged miniature lamp can provide light in a place with weak lamplight at night, brain wave information of a wearer can be monitored at any time through an arranged potential chip and a signal processor, if information is disordered, family members of the wearer are remotely informed through the arranged signal transceiver to achieve remote protection, and the outdoor PH value can be detected in real time through the arranged PH detector to protect the wearer.
